Vertical Blind Factory of Naples 2805 Horseshoe Dr S Ste 7Naples, FL, 34104 View Phone 239-228-8113 2805 Horseshoe Dr S Ste 7Naples, FL 34104 View Website Experience & Reliability About Photos & Videos Send to My Email Send to My Phone Print this Page